What to do if you get a 1099-G unemployment tax form from IDES

These statements report the total amount of benefits paid to a claimant in the previous calendar year for tax purposes. The amount reported is based upon the actual payment dates, not the week covered by the payment or the date the claimant requested the payment. The amount on the 1099-G may include the total of benefits from more than one claim.

    New Exclusion Of Up To $10200 Of Unemployment Compensation

    If your modified adjusted gross income is less than $150,000, the American Rescue Plan enacted on March 11, 2021, excludes from income up to $10,200 of unemployment compensation paid in 2020, which means you dont have to pay tax on unemployment compensation of up to $10,200. If you are married, each spouse receiving unemployment compensation doesnt have to pay tax on unemployment compensation of up to $10,200. Amounts over $10,200 for each individual are still taxable. If your modified AGI is $150,000 or more, you cant exclude any unemployment compensation. If you file Form 1040-NR, you cant exclude any unemployment compensation for your spouse.

    The exclusion should be reported separately from your unemployment compensation. See the updated instructions and the Unemployment Compensation Exclusion Worksheet to figure your exclusion and the amount to enter on Schedule 1, line 8.

    When figuring the following deductions or exclusions from income, if you are asked to enter an amount from Schedule 1, line 7 enter the total amount of unemployment compensation reported on line 7 and if you are asked to enter an amount from Schedule 1, line 8, enter the amount from line 3 of the Unemployment Compensation Exclusion Worksheet. See the specific form or instructions for more information. If you file Form 1040-NR, you arent eligible for all of these deductions. See the Instructions for Form 1040-NR for details.

    Faq: Paying Federal Income Tax On Your Unemployment Insurance Benefits

    Although the state of New Jersey does not tax Unemployment Insurance benefits, they are subject to federal income taxes.

    For important information on the 2020 tax year, click here.

    Below are answers to frequently asked questions about benefit payments and taxes.

    I received a 1099-G but did not receive Unemployment Insurance compensation payments in 2020. What does this mean?

    If you receive a 1099-G but did not receive Unemployment Insurance compensation payments in 2020, you may be the victim of identity theft. Please report your case of suspected fraud as soon as possible online or by calling our fraud hotline at 609-777-4304.

    What if the amounts on my 1099-G form are not correct?

    Please note: Your 1099-G reflects the total amount paid to you in 2020, regardless of the week that payment represents.

    Meaning, if you were paid in 2020 for weeks of unemployment benefits from 2019, those will appear on your 1099-G for 2020. Similarly, if you were paid for 2020 weeks in 2021, those will not be on your 1099-G for 2020 they will appear on your 1099-G for 2021.

    If you were overpaid benefits, your 1099-G will still reflect, per federal law, the amount of funds paid to you, regardless of any funds you have returned. Please refer to the section titled Repayments in the IRS Publication 525 Taxable and Nontaxable Income for guidance on how to report overpayments/returned funds.

    How To Prepare For Your 2020 Tax Bill

    Contact your unemployment office immediately if you do owe tax on your unemployment benefits and are concerned about being able to pay. You can start having income tax withheld from your payments if you havent already done so and if youre still collecting.

    If youre still collecting unemployment benefits, see if you can opt in to having federal and state taxes withheld, Capelli said.

    It probably wont solve your whole problem with the 10% withholding cap in place, but it will somewhat defray the impact of those benefits being included in your income. Ask for Form W-4V, fill it out, and file it with your unemployment office.

    What If Youre A Freelancer In Nj Who Has Clients Based In Ny

    If you dont actually step into any of your clients offices in New York, then you can claim that work as New Jersey income, says Feinberg, because 1) your business operates entirely out of your home office in New Jersey and 2) all of the work is conducted at home. Likewise, if you attend meetings in New York, but the bulk of the actual work takes place at home, then you can consider that to be New Jersey income.

    What gets more complicated is if you are a freelancer and have to work in other states. Ideally, you would file in every state that you work in, says Feinberg, but that can become complicated if you are traveling to work in multiple other states, not just New York.

    Feinberg notes that each case is unique with its own circumstances. You have to look at many factors, he says. If the clients are based in New York, if the checks are written in New York, if your bank account is in New York, etc. These help determine where you should file. The key is to look at the source state of the income.

    How Do I Get My 1099 2020

    Online

  • Log in to Benefit Programs Online and select UI Online.
  • Select Form 1099G.
  • Select View next to the desired year. This link will only appear if you received benefits from the EDD for that year.
  • Select Print to print your Form 1099G information.
  • Select Request Duplicate to request an official paper copy.

    What Do You Need To File A Claim

    In most states, self-employed or 1099 workers will need to provide the following information when applying for unemployment benefits:

    • Name, full mailing address, and phone number.
    • Driver’s license or state ID number.
    • Social Security or Alien Registration number and drivers license number.
    • Proof of income, which can include 1099 tax forms, 1099 pay stubs, Form 1040 tax returns and tax returns.
    • Bank account number and routing number for direct deposit of benefits.

    Keep in mind that each state will have specific requirements, so do your research and collect all relevant documents before starting the unemployment application process.

    Is A 1099 G Form Good Or Bad

    Is a 1099 G taxable income? Unemployment compensation is generally taxable income to you, so Form 1099-G gives you the amount of unemployment benefits you must report on your tax return. You may opt to have federal income tax withheld on those benefits. If you do, the amount withheld will be reported in Box 4.
